Ingesting Data from AWS Databricks Delta Share into Fabric Warehouse

Hello, I have a Databricks Delta Share on an AWS Databricks Account and need to ingest data into a Fabric Warehouse (Note: Lakehouse is not an option for this requirement, so Lakehouse-based solutio...

    Currently, Microsoft Fabric does not offer a built-in connector that allows direct querying or exposure of Delta Share tables from AWS Databricks into a Fabric Warehouse. The Unity Catalog mirroring feature is supported only with Azure Databricks and has not been extended to AWS Databricks at this time.

     

    • As a workaround, you can automate the ingestion of data from AWS Databricks Delta Share into an intermediate staging layer such as Azure Blob Storage or Azure SQL Database. From there, the data can be ingested into a Fabric Warehouse using T-SQL notebooks or Dataflows Gen2.
    • It's also worth noting that while Lakehouse is currently the only Fabric-native destination with potential support for open Delta Sharing, Warehouse-based direct ingestion from Delta Share is not supported at this stage.
    • Additionally, Fabric now supports direct access to Azure Databricks Unity Catalog tables through the Mirrored Azure Databricks Catalog feature.
    • If you're working with Azure Databricks, this provides a seamless way to integrate Unity Catalog-managed data across other Fabric experiences, including Power BI.
    • For AWS-hosted Delta Shares, however a middle-tier ingestion strategy remains necessary until native support becomes available.
